Santa Maria del Cedro

Santa Maria del Cedro is a town and comune in the province of Cosenza, Calabria, Italy.

The town's name indicates the cultivation of the special diamante citron, which is used as Etrog by the Jews during their Feast of Tabernacles.

Sights include remains of Norman castle and aqueduct.
